Diabetes Programs/Activities

Our programs work toward decreasing diabetes prevalence and diabetes-related complications such as: amputations, renal disease, cardiovascular disease, and blindness.

We promote:

  • Enhanced awareness of diabetes and the complications of diabetes to all Ohioans
  • Increased control of diabetes for those who have been diagnosed
  • Access to quality care for those disproportionately affected populations with diabetes
  • Improved care of services for underserved populations with diabetes in Ohio
  • Quality diabetes education- including the promotion of wellness, physical activity, weight and blood pressure control, and smoking cessation
  • Self management
  • Partnerships
  • Community involvement and capacity building
